Transfer and Backup of Text Messages (SMS)
Černý, František ; Křivka, Zbyněk (referee) ; Kolář, Dušan (advisor)
The subject of this bachelor thesis are two cooperating applications to backup, restore and to view SMS messages. The first of the implemented applications, designed for the Android operating system can backup and restore SMS messages using XML file. The application also enables synchronization of the imported file with existing short text messages. The second application is used as an extension for Thunderbird email client. This extension lets you view imported text messages, synchronize your saved short text messages with contacts in SMS threads, search in saved file and synchronize existing SMS information with newly imported file. The extension also allows exporting a file with SMS messages and uses this exported file in application for Android operating system.

Contact erosion of switchgear under real conditions
Holoubek, Josef ; Bušov, Bohuslav (referee) ; Valenta, Jiří (advisor)
This bachelor thesis is focused on the material loss - contacts erosion during switching process of the switchgears. First part is focused on the switchgears generally, their dividing and functions. Then there is closer look on the contacts of switchgears and what is necessary to be considered during their designing a operating. In this part there is also section devoted to the theory of the contacts erosion including the formulas for material loss calculation, which I found in existing literature. Practical part is focused on the contact system model and the measuring performed on this model. Measuring was also performed on the real switchgears for common use. There is also part devoted to this measuring. In the last part of thesis the analyze of the measured values is performed.

Contact erosion of switching devices
Píška, Jakub ; Šimek, David (referee) ; Valenta, Jiří (advisor)
This bachelor thesis deals with the erosion of contacts, as one of the negative phenomena affecting contacts of switchgears. In its first part, it briefly summarizes the other negative influences that must be considered when designing switching devices. In the following part, the physical mechanism of erosion and the primary criterion of assessment - weight loss are approached. The last and main part of the work deals with design of the contact system for comparing this loss for for frequently used materials and testing on a real switchgear. After the tests, the results were analyzed primarily from the perspective of ignition angles, the polarities of the current pulse and the current flowing through the arc. Taking into account the influence of the material composition, the size of the contacts and the presence of the arc-runner.
